Skip to main content

Twatgina

A person who is not liked.

(invented as a term to describe my physics teacher after the whole class failed)

Please become a fan of the Facebook page "Twatgina"
He is such a Twatgina!
by Dr Bastard March 20, 2010
mugGet the Twatginamug.

twatgina

Pussy, usually refers to a cowardly male.
Chris is a twatgina becuase he is a pussy.
by TheBeav2 June 4, 2005
mugGet the twatginamug.

Share this definition